This specific file is a RAR archive segment. RAR is a proprietary archive file format that supports data compression, error recovery, and file spanning. When you see a suffix like .part07.rar, it indicates that this is the seventh piece of a larger set.

To access the contents within, you generally need all parts of the archive (e.g., part01 through the final segment). If even one part—like part07—is missing or corrupted, the extraction process will fail, as the data is spread across the entire sequence. How Multi-Part RAR Archives Work

Large digital assets, such as high-definition videos, software installers, or massive database backups, can reach dozens of gigabytes. Splitting these into smaller "parts" (often 500MB to 2GB each) serves several practical purposes:

Download Stability: If a connection drops, you only need to re-download one small segment rather than a massive single file.

Storage Limitations: Smaller files can be stored across multiple physical disks or FAT32-formatted drives that have a 4GB file size limit.

If you encounter an error while processing part07, it is likely due to one of the following:

Missing Parts: Check your folder to ensure no numbers in the sequence are skipped.

Checksum Errors (CRC): This means the data in part07 was corrupted during the download. You will usually need to delete that specific part and download it again.

Wrong Version: Ensure you are using a modern version of your extraction software, as older versions may not support newer RAR5 compression algorithms.
